Summary

This is a multicenter, randomized, single-blind, positive-controlled, non-inferiority clinical trial designed to evaluate the safety and effectiveness of an absorbable medical adhesive (developed by Guangzhou Maipu Regenerative Medical Technology Co., Ltd.) as an adjunctive method for dural repair in neurosurgery to prevent cerebrospinal fluid (CSF) leakage. A total of 132 subjects (1:1 randomization, 66 in the test group and 66 in the control group) were enrolled across 9 centers in China. The test device is an absorbable medical adhesive composed of polyethylene glycol (PEG) derivatives. The control device is the commercially available absorbable polymeric tissue sealing film (TissuePatchSF, TissueMed Ltd., UK NMPA Registration No. 20163641547). The primary efficacy endpoint is the success rate of postoperative prevention of CSF leakage (assessed at Day 7 ± 3 days post-surgery). Secondary efficacy endpoints include intraoperative CSF leak prevention success rate, postoperative subcutaneous fluid accumulation rate, and scalp incision healing. Safety endpoints include adverse events, serious adverse events, central nervous system infection, and pseudomeningocele. Subjects were followed for 3 months post-surgery. The study was completed in April 2021.

Interventions

DEVICE

Absorbable Medical Adhesive

A synthetic absorbable medical adhesive composed of polyethylene glycol (PEG) derivatives (electrophilic and nucleophilic components) that crosslink to form a hydrogel upon mixing. It provides a watertight seal and enhances tissue adhesion through ionic interactions between cationic groups on the nucleophilic component and anions in tissue matrices. The product is biodegradable and has low swelling ratio.Guangzhou Maipu Regenerative Medical Technology Co., Ltd.

DEVICE

TissuePatchSF (Absorbable Polymeric Tissue Sealing Film)

A synthetic absorbable polymeric tissue sealing film indicated as an adjunctive sealant for dural repair in neurosurgery. The product is applied directly to the dural repair site to provide a watertight seal. TissueMed Ltd. (UK) .NMPA Registration No.: 国械注进20163641547
